S-80858CNUA-B9JT2G belongs to the category of integrated circuits (ICs).
This IC is commonly used as a voltage detector in various electronic devices.

The S-80858CNUA-B9JT2G operates by comparing the input voltage with a reference voltage. When the input voltage falls below the detection threshold, the IC triggers the output pin, indicating an undervoltage condition.
